Sky Stack
This worksheet introduces students to the layers of Earth’s atmosphere, such as the troposphere, stratosphere, and thermosphere. It includes a mix of scientific vocabulary relating to atmospheric structure and phenomena like jet streams, ozone layers, and lapse rates. These terms are foundational to understanding how the atmosphere behaves and affects weather and climate.
Engaging with this worksheet strengthens scientific literacy by making students familiar with technical terms in atmospheric science. They practice locating complex, multi-syllabic words, reinforcing spelling and meaning retention. Reading skills improve as students must match patterns quickly. The exercise also encourages attention to detail and boosts working memory.
